Script Aflir 4 is a light, very narrow, high contrast, upright, short x-height font.

A tall, slender handwritten script with a lively, slightly bouncy rhythm and pronounced vertical emphasis. Strokes show strong thick–thin modulation reminiscent of pen pressure, with tapered entries and exits and occasional swash-like terminals. Letterforms are mostly unconnected in all-caps and more fluid in lowercase, relying on consistent slant-free posture, narrow counters, and elongated ascenders/descenders to create an elegant, airy texture. Numerals and punctuation follow the same calligraphic logic, with rounded bowls and delicate joins.

Well-suited for short display text such as invitations, greeting cards, boutique branding, product packaging, and social graphics where a handmade voice is desirable. It performs best in headings, names, and short phrases where the delicate contrast and tall proportions can be appreciated without crowding.

The overall tone feels personable and whimsical, like neat hand-lettering for invitations or craft packaging. Its light, delicate presence and looping details convey charm and approachability rather than formality or authority.

The design appears intended to emulate casual modern calligraphy—refined enough for celebratory or lifestyle contexts, but still clearly hand-drawn. Its narrow, vertical structure and pressure-driven strokes aim to provide an elegant script presence while staying friendly and informal.

Capitals feature simplified, ornamental strokes that read well as initials, while lowercase shows more expressive loops (notably in letters with descenders) that add movement in word shapes. Spacing appears open enough to keep the narrow forms from feeling cramped, though the high contrast details suggest best use at display sizes.
